#FA8136 Hex Color Code

#FA8136

The Hexadecimal Color #FA8136 is a contrast shade of Coral. #FA8136 RGB value is rgb(250, 129, 54). RGB Color Model of #FA8136 consists of 98% red, 50% green and 21% blue. HSL color Mode of #FA8136 has 23°(degrees) Hue, 95% Saturation and 60% Lightness. #FA8136 color has an wavelength of 605.51852n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#FA8136 is #FF9966.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#FA8136 is #F83. The Closest Color to #FA8136 is #FF7F50. Official Name of #FA8136 Hex Code is Jaffa.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#FA8136 is 0 Cyan 48 Magenta 78 Yellow 2 Black and #FA8136 CMY is 0, 48, 78.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#FA8136 is hsl(23,95,60,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(23, 78, 98).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#FA8136 is 47.95, 36.3, 7.97.
Hex8 Value of #FA8136 is #FA8136FF. Decimal Value of #FA8136 is 16417078 and Octal Value of #FA8136 is 76500466. Binary Value of #FA8136 is 11111010, 10000001, 110110 and Android of #FA8136 is 4294607158 / 0xfffa8136.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#FA8136 is 0.52, 0.394, 0.394 and YIQ Color Space of #FA8136 is 156.629, 96.2014, 2.2515.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#FA8136 is 49.44, 27.93, 8.48.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#FA8136 is 66.75, 41.36, 59.01.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#FA8136 is 66.75, 98.35, 53.54.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#FA8136 is 66.75, 72.06, 54.97. Hunter Lab variable of #FA8136 is 60.25, 36.62, 34.33.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#FA8136

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
